PU Syndicate meeting on January 27

The Syndicate meeting of the Panjab University (PU), scheduled for January 27, will witness discussion on issue pertaining to nomination of certain members to the Board of Studies of various department.

The Syndics will also deliberate on the matter of extending the date of PhD thesis submission and will take a call on the formation committees to be formed for periodic inspections of all the colleges affiliated to PU. Once these committees will be formed then these would have to submit the inspection reports in a stipulated time frame.

Moreover, deliberations will also be made on an information where UGC has extended the date of refresher courses meant for teachers to December 31, 2013. The meeting would also decide on the eligibility criteria of candidates applying for the posts of professors and assistant professors.

The Syndicate will decide whether those students having aggregate marks 60 per cent would be allowed to take improvement examination in the said course. Furthermore, the meeting would also make appointments to the UMC committee and will also decide the case of four students caught by the UMC last year.
